EUGENE, Ore. — University of South Carolina Men’s Golf standouts Keenan Huskey and Matt NeSmith were named to the NCAA Division I PING All-Southeast Region Team, the Golf Coaches Association of America announced today. The All-Region selection is Huskey’s first and NeSmith’s fourth.

A sophomore from Greenville, S.C., Huskey earned medalist honors at the Camden Collegiate Invitational and the Hootie and Bulls Bay Intercollegiate this season, his first two collegiate victories. His 72.14 stroke average at the beginning of the NCAA Championship currently ranks second on the Gamecock team and 10th-best in South Carolina’s single-season history.

NeSmith has also netted two individual titles this season, at the Palmetto Intercollegiate and the General Hackler Championship. A senior from North Augusta, S.C., NeSmith leads the team and ranks third on the single-season Gamecock record list with a 71.09 stroke average.

A First Team All-SEC pick, NeSmith has also been honored with PING All-America laurels in 2013 and 2015. His career stroke average of 71.62 is a school record, as are his 25 individual top 10 finishes.

Led by Huskey and NeSmith, the Gamecocks are currently playing the 2016 NCAA Division I Men’s Golf Championship in Eugene, Ore. It’s the fourth consecutive nationals bid for the Gamecocks.
